Nicole,
If he is in State prison, he will get a 60 day review first then one every 6 months. Arizona doesn't really have "parole" anymore. Inmates are released on "temporary release" 3 months prior to their earned credit release date --- this is really the only parole they have now. (I believe there are some long timers who might still be under the parole clause.)
Right now Arizona inmates are required to serve 85% of their time. They call it 6 for 1. Essentially for every week of time, they can subtract 1 day for "good time".
As far as appeal...I have no idea. I think the attorney he had when sentenced could tell you when he can start filing an appeal.
Have you gone to the Arizona DOC website? You can look up the inmate and see when the next review date is sceduled for him. Their website : http://www.adc.state.az.us/ISearch.htm.
